Fifth business is a dramatic term denoting a character who is neither the hero nor the villain in the play, but the person who precipitates the events taking place. Dempster this story begins on the twenty seventh of december 1908, as a snowball possessing a rock inside is thrown by percy boyd staunton and in failing to hit his friend the young, ten year old dunstan ramsay it hits the sensitive, fragile and pregnant mary dempster. Fifth business is narrated by dunstable later dunstan ramsay, who grows up in deptford, a fictional town in southwestern ontario, canada.

Fifth business is a role which is neither hero nor villain, but which is a necessary feature of a dramatic or operatic plot at least thats what the quotation at the front of the novel says, and what is said within it about fifth business. Fifth business definition those roles which, being neither those of hero nor heroine, confidante nor villain, but which were nonetheless essential to bring about the recognition or the denouement, were called the fifth business in drama and opera companies organized according to the old style.
